Rumours have been circulating that we will hear some concrete news on Microsoft’s upgraded Xbox One (via Gamespot), codenamed Project Scorpio, later this week.
On Twitter, Windows Central editor Jez Corden has suggested that news is right around the corner.
It’s true that Project Scorpio is going to be shown off very soon.

While The Inner Circle podcast has said that specs will be revealed through Digital Foundry on Thursday.

Xbox head Phil Spencer also took to Twitter to satiate those looking for answers.
@dragen_Light Yea, I know why you ask. We are very happy with what we are seeing from 1P and 3P, you’ll hear more soon. Sorry for the wait.
— Phil Spencer (@XboxP3) April 2, 2017
With Project Scorpio expected to feature heavily in Microsoft’s E3 showcase in June, it makes sense that some news would be on the horizon regarding the new Xbox, so now we wait…
